What you will do:
The Home Based Services Nurse Educator will be responsible for developing, providing, and coordinating education throughout their unit. This includes nurses, patient care technicians, certified nursing assistants and ward clerks. The Educator collaborates with unit leadership to help determine educational needs within the unit(s) as well as with other nursing education professionals to coordinate and implement needed and required education at the nursing unit level.
The Educator will assist with the assessment, planning, implementation and evaluation of educational services offered at the unit level. Ongoing programs include: unit based orientation, unit based preceptor development and management, unit based resident development and management, and annual competency assessment in conjunction with unit leadership.
